Stock Track | Alkermes Plunges 5.18% in Pre-market After Q2 Earnings Show Sharp Profit Decline

Alkermes PLC (ALKS) shares tumbled 5.18% in pre-market trading on Tuesday, following the release of the company's second-quarter financial results. The decline comes despite the company reporting breakeven earnings per share, which narrowly beat analysts' expectations of a $0.03 loss.

While revenue for the quarter rose to $496 million, up from $390.7 million a year earlier and above the FactSet consensus of $457.4 million, the bottom-line performance marked a significant drop from the $0.52 per share earned in the same period last year. The company also reiterated its full-year 2026 revenue guidance of $1.73 billion to $1.84 billion, in line with analyst expectations of $1.81 billion.

The sharp year-over-year decline in profitability appears to have overshadowed the top-line beat and the maintained guidance, prompting investors to sell off shares in the pre-market session.
